David Caruso’s career peaked in the 1990s and early 2000s, with his roles on NYPD Blue and CSI: Miami cementing his status as a television legend. However, since stepping away from acting after the conclusion of CSI: Miami in 2012, Caruso has adopted a more reclusive lifestyle. Sources describe him as living like a “frugal hermit,” avoiding Hollywood events and social gatherings despite his estimated net worth of $25 million.
This withdrawal from the public eye has coincided with a noticeable decline in his physical health. Experts believe that Caruso’s sedentary lifestyle, combined with poor dietary habits, has contributed to his substantial weight gain. Dr. Gabe Mirkin, a Florida-based lifespan expert, estimates that Caruso now weighs over 215 pounds and is suffering from “massive abdominal obesity.” This condition, characterized by excessive fat around the stomach area, poses serious health risks, including fatty liver disease, diabetes, and increased risk of premature death.
Dr. Mirkin warns that Caruso’s liver is likely “full of fat,” which can lead to life-threatening complications if left untreated. The doctor also suspects that Caruso may be battling diabetes, a common comorbidity associated with obesity.
